Human Computer Interaction
Human Computer Interaction gives you state-of-the-art knowledge and skills in designing, developing and evaluating digital interactive systems. You will study human-centred design principles, methods of User Experience (UX) research, design, prototyping and evaluation, as well as specialised interaction techniques, preparing you for careers in UX design, product management and user research.
